A research company surveys 8,000 people. The company expects 6,000 people to respond favorably. If there is a percent error of 2
.5%, what is the range of people who will respond favorably to the survey? please help
1 answer:
Answer:
400
Step-by-step explanation:
6/8 = 0.75 or 75% expected to respond favorably.
Margin of error 2.5%:
Lower bound: 0.75 - .025 = 0.725
Upper bound: 0.75 + .025 = 0.775
Range:
Lower bound: 8000 * 0.725 = 5800
Upper bound: 8000 * 0.775 = 6200
6200 - 5800 = 400
